Open

You can download these and run them yourself — on your own computer, or on any cloud service you choose. Once you have the files, no company can take them away, shut them down, or change how they work.

Closed

These only run on the maker's own servers. You use them through an app or a paid connection — like ChatGPT or Claude — but you can never download them or run them yourself.
